Sir Thomas Masterman Hardy (1769-1839), British naval officer, 1837. Hardy served as Flag Captain to Admiral Nelson and commanded the HMS Victory at the Battle of Trafalgar

This print showcases Sir Thomas Masterman Hardy, a distinguished British naval officer from the 18th and 19th centuries. In this portrait captured in 1837, Hardy exudes an air of authority and strength befitting his esteemed position. Hardy's notable career includes serving as Flag Captain to Admiral Nelson, one of Britain's most revered naval commanders. He commanded the HMS Victory during the historic Battle of Trafalgar, a pivotal moment in British history. This image immortalizes him as a key figure in naval warfare.
